
Electric Muscle Stim (EMS), often referred to as electrical stimulation or "e-stim," is a therapeutic modality used at Sports & Spinal Wellness Center in Albany, NY, to support muscle function and patient comfort. This technology involves the use of gentle electrical pulses to elicit muscle contractions or provide sensory input to the nervous system. The technology works by placing small, adhesive pads on the skin over specific muscle groups. These pads deliver controlled impulses that mimic the signals the brain sends to the muscles. This can be particularly helpful for individuals who are experiencing muscle weakness or those whose movement is limited by physical tension.
